PLT to highlight its portfolio of 'beverage-friendly' ingredients at IFT First 2025
Monday, 16 June, 2025, 08 : 00 AM [IST]
New Jersey, USA
At this year's IFT First Conference in Chicago, IL USA, PLT Health Solutions, Inc., will be highlighting its growing portfolio of 'beverage-friendly' ingredients that provide a broad range of science-backed benefits for the burgeoning functional beverage market. Overall, it markets more than a dozen water-dispersible and water-soluble solutions. At IFT, the company will be focusing on four major health and wellness segments – energy, cognitive, sports/active nutrition and weight management. 

New at the show this year is cellflo6, an experiential ingredient for use in energy and sports beverages that offers the benefits of energy, endurance, recovery and enhanced blood flow. Most of its beverage-friendly ingredients are designed to enhance the consumer experience of finished products, as they are fast-acting compared to similar ingredient solutions on the market. The company will also be giving a presentation on a new clinical study of Zynamite, an award-winning ingredient that fosters enhanced non-stim energy, mood and cognitive performance at the IFT Taste of Science & Sample Stop Event.

Steve Fink, vice president of marketing at PLT Health Solutions, said, “Consumer experience is becoming a critical factor for product success—especially in the beverage sector. Efficacy will always be the foundation when it comes to science-backed ingredients. But today's consumers expect more than just results—they're looking for products that align with their values and deliver a complete experience. That includes clean sourcing, traceability, and certifications—but also faster effects, enjoyable delivery formats, and standout packaging. In many ways, the experience of a product has become just as important as the science behind it. At IFT, we want the food and beverage industry to visit our booth, sample our ingredients and feel the science.” 

For several years, functional beverages have been one of the fastest growing segments of the natural products industry. At IFT, it will be featuring beverage-friendly ingredients that add more function than traditional ingredients like vitamins, protein and minerals.

The company offers both stimulant and non-stim energy ingredients with its zumXR Extended-Release Caffeine and Zynamite – via the new Zynamite S format. Both are subjects of recently completed clinical trials.

Cognitive ingredients presented at IFT First 2025 include Rhodiolife Rhodolia rosea, a true adaptogen offering reduced mental and physical stress and emotional balance. Also featured will be Zembrin Sceletium tortuosum that has extensive clinical work showing reduced stress and enhanced mood in less than 2 hours from ingestion.

As part of its Sports/Active Nutrition portfolio, beverage friendly ingredients include MegaNatual-BP grape seed extract and cellflo6 for enhanced blood flow and improved physical performance. cellflo6 has found success in experiential sports nutrition formulations.

Its award-winning weight management ingredient portfolio will feature beverage friendly Slendacor Weight Management Complex and Supresa Crave Control. Slendacor has been the subject of multiple clinical studies that have demonstrated fast-acting weight loss, non-stimulant calorie burning and body shaping. Supresa has been clinically demonstrated to help people resist the urge to snack.

According to Fink, with consumers increasingly turning to convenient delivery systems, the company has undertaken an across-the-board campaign to create or modify its ingredients to make them formulation-friendly. He said, "For a variety of reasons, beverages present a range of challenges when it comes to consumer sensory and experience. This is especially true when it comes to plant-based and botanical ingredients. In approaching this development work, we've focused on things beverage producers want: uniform particle size and density, good water dispersibility/solubility, neutral taste and colour and stability. At the same time, our beverage-friendly ingredients maintain features that every product developer wants: they are fast-acting to the point of being experiential, they are low dose and maybe most importantly, they are backed by quality clinical science."
